Output 1844561a2c62acabae40b68bb2482ced471cad52597ef765274a84254c0ba469:6

value
6516857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 505a25a4223fa5258c6bf65b389e4173957c8aea OP_EQUALVERIFY OP_CHECKSIG
address
18Ks3sbMw8A861J7y3mDcqEQoiJ4ESVfFZ
transaction
1844561a2c62acabae40b68bb2482ced471cad52597ef765274a84254c0ba469
confirmations
189382
spent
true